Output 44226a250163c60835c544cf28bd15f2df0c137b749589fa0bd647626365bc8f:1

value
654059
script pubkey
OP_0 OP_PUSHBYTES_20 df31d5e2b0e40d5409d2eb1c99fd5211b571c89a
address
bc1qmucatc4susx4gzwjavwfnl2jzx6hrjy6tv7k0g
transaction
44226a250163c60835c544cf28bd15f2df0c137b749589fa0bd647626365bc8f